I recently dined at The Valley View Restaurant, situated within the Sarvakaya Hill Resort premises. First and foremost, I'd like to highlight that the route to this resort can be quite challenging at night, so I recommend planning your visit during daylight hours for safety.
True to its name, The Valley View Restaurant offers a picturesque dining experience with a stunning view of the valley. It's a pure vegetarian restaurant, and my overall impression of the food was positive.
To start, we ordered the veg ball Manchurian and honey chilli potato for appetizers, and they were both absolutely delightful. The flavors were on point, and they left us craving for more.
Moving on to the main course, we opted for butter naan and pulkhas with Paneer Methi Chaman, which was highlighted as the chef's special on the menu. Unfortunately, it didn't live up to our expectations. The dish lacked flavor and depth, but it improved slightly after we added some salt and a dash of lemon.
We also ordered Dal, which was just average and didn't stand out. One disappointment we encountered was when we requested to have the leftover Dal packed to take with us. Surprisingly, the restaurant staff declined, citing that they don't have the means to pack food.
Overall, our dining experience at The Valley View Restaurant was pleasant, with decent food and an exceptional view. However, it's important to note that the service was quite slow during our visit.
